> I saw this PROLIFIC context flag and I wonder (haven't tried until
> now) if with this flag it is possoble to allow a context (not the root
> context) to create new contexts. Is this true?

yes, thats the idea, but it isn't implemented (yet)
(it's there for future development :)

> Are the contexts nested (assume no)? 

nope, but the structures for doing so are already there

> How can I enter the new context from the creating non-root context?

basically the same way you do on the host now, given
that the context has the required capabilities and
flags
